Signs of a slow recovery in manufacturing so far this year – which were in part being driven by improvements in production in Europe and Asia – may now be threatened by escalating geopolitical tension in Europe on the back of the Russia-Ukraine conflict and a simultaneous resurgence of the Covid-19 virus in China, research and consulting firm Frost & Sullivan consulting analyst Nomvo Kasolo said on March 17. “However, pockets of opportunity exist for markets that can fill the gaps in exports from Russia,” she noted.
